CSS3 3D动画技术入门与示例先了解几个术语,透视(perspective)、旋转(rotate)和移动(translate)。Perspective(透视)透视即是以现实的视角来看屏幕上的2D事物,从而展现3D的效果。在计算机世界怎么表达3D呢?上方图可以辅助大家理解3D的透视perspective,黄色的是电脑或手机屏幕,红色是屏幕里的方块。CSS3 3D transform的透视点是在浏览
转载
2023-10-12 22:55:38
238阅读
HTML5与CSS3之3D转换
原创
2023-07-26 19:40:47
134阅读
《数百个 HTML5 例子学习 HT 图形组件 – WebGL 3D 篇》里提到 很多情况下不需要借助 3Ds Max 和 Blender 等专业 3D 建模工具也能做出很多效果,例如 这个 3D 电信机房监控例子整个都是通过 提供的 API 构建而成:不过这个例子中的模型都比较规矩,也就消防栓由一个球 + 圆通构成,其他图形通过
原标题:基于 HTML5 WebGL 的 3D 场景中的灯光效果构建 3D 的场景除了创建模型,对模型设置颜色和贴图外,还需要有灯光的效果才能更逼真的反映真实世界的场景。这个例子我觉得既美观又代表性很强,所以拿出来给大家分享一下。本例地址:http://www.hightopo.com/guide/guide/core/lighting/examples/example_flowing.html例
转载
2024-08-22 19:48:56
75阅读
原标题:玩转 HTML5 下 WebGL 的 3D 模型交并补CSG 构造实体几何这个概念在工业水利水电施工上、游戏上已经有很多人使用了,最简单的实体表示叫作体元,通常是形状简单的物体,如立方体、圆柱体、棱柱、棱锥、球体、圆锥等。根据每个软件包的不同这些体元也有所不同,在一些软件包中可以使用弯曲的物体进行 CSG 处理,在另外一些软件包中则不支持这些功能。构造物体就是将体元根据集合论的布尔逻辑组合
转载
2024-08-11 22:36:36
228阅读
项目代码:1. 基本介绍 Explore Space 是⼀款以宇宙空间为主题,应⽤了Web 3D、前端机器学习等新颖 Web 技 术,前后端功能完备的 Web 应⽤。包括以下两⼤核⼼功能:适⽤于教学/科普的模型展示场景基于3D地球的数据可视化2. 亮点/创新点基于 JWT 的⽤户认证基于 Three.js 实现的 Web 3D 场景基于 Tensorflow.js 实现的前端机器学习模
转载
2023-08-16 17:05:00
415阅读
一、HTML5与HTML的区别1、文档声明区别HTML文档的类型声明为:HTML5文档的类型声明为:HTML5.0:文档声明HTML5方便书写,精简,有利于程序员快速的阅读和开发。2、结构语义区别html:没有体现结构语义化的标签,如:<div id="nav"></div>html5:添加了许多具有语义化的标签,如:<article>、<aside>
转载
2023-07-27 21:34:15
234阅读
# HTML5 3D建模软件开发指南
## 引言
作为一名经验丰富的开发者,我将向你介绍如何实现HTML5 3D建模软件。这篇文章将以1200字左右的篇幅详细讲解整个开发流程,包括每一步所需的代码和注释。
## 开发流程
为了更直观地展示整个流程,我将使用表格展示每个步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建HTML文件 |
| 2 | 引入Three.js
原创
2024-06-20 06:06:55
94阅读
html5和css3是前端学习的重要组成部分,但很多同学在学习前端的时候,对html5和css3不是很了解。下面本篇文章就来给大家简单介绍一下html5和css3,希望对大家有所帮助。什么是HTML5?HTML5是超文本标记语言(HTML)的修订版,第五次重大修改版本;而HTML是用于描述网页内容和外观的标准编程语言。HTML5支持传统的HTML和XHTML样式语法以及其标记,新API,XHTML
转载
2023-07-21 15:32:13
112阅读
1)Html5详解。 2)CSS3选择器详解。 3)CSS3属性详解(图文教程)。 4)CSS预处理器之Less详解。什么是 HTML5HTML5并不仅仅只是做为HTML标记语言的一个最新版本,更重要的是它制定了Web应用开发的一系列标准,成为第一个将Web做为应用开发平台的HTML语言。HTML5定义了一系列新元素,如新语义标签、智能表单、多媒体标签等,可以帮助开发者创建富互联网应用,还提供了一
转载
2023-07-21 17:08:34
26阅读
文章目录第11章 用CSS进行布局11.1 开始布局的注意事项11.2 构建页面11.4 对默认样式进行重置或标准化11.5 盒模型11.6 控制元素的显示类型和可见性11.7 设置元素的高度11.8 在元素周围添加内边距11.9 设置边框11.11 使元素浮动11.12 控制元素浮动的位置11.12 控制元素浮动的位置11.13 对元素进行相对定位11.14 对元素进行绝对定位11.15 在栈
转载
2023-07-10 20:24:28
99阅读
DAY08伪类选择器和垂直对齐 一、动态伪类选择器:link 设置链接未点击时的状态 注意点:需要清除浏览器缓存 ,主要给a标签 :visted 设置访问过后的样式 主要给a:hover 鼠标悬停时的状态:active 点击过后的状态注:如果都给a需要注意顺
转载
2023-07-21 15:51:55
144阅读
对以前来讲,3D动画拿到网页上展示是一件非常奢侈的事情,第一是浏览器不够先进,第二是大部分只能用flash实现伪3D。HTML5的出现,让实现网页3D动画变得非常简单,当然前提是你不要再使用像IE678之类的浏览器了。下面精选的几款HTML5 3D动画,希望你会喜欢。1、HTML5 SVG 3D空间模型 可拖拽缩放这是一个基于HTML5和SVG的3D空间模型,这个3D模型提供了x、y、z三个坐标轴
转载
2023-07-24 02:48:58
874阅读
# HTML5和CSS3实现3D立体旋转相册
近年来,随着互联网技术的发展,HTML5和CSS3逐渐成为前端开发的标准。它们不仅简化了网页布局,还增强了视觉效果和用户体验。在这篇文章中,我们将通过一个示例来展示如何使用HTML5和CSS3实现一个3D立体旋转相册,提升页面的互动性和美观性。
## 1. 项目概述
我们要实现的是一个可以在网页中查看的相册,用户可以通过鼠标悬停或滚动鼠标来旋转相
原创
2024-08-20 06:41:39
369阅读
CSS3实现3D效果 1. 涉及到的几个CSS3属性 首先大家需要了解transform属性,主要有平移(translate),缩放(scale),拉伸(skew),旋转(rotate)。 这里涉及到3d转换的主要介绍旋转。 下面通过一组rotate效果直观理解rotateX,rotateY,rotateZ区别。 代码: .box{ width: 200p
转载
2023-08-29 10:57:24
0阅读
插件简介之前我们分享过一些比较有意思的滑杆控件,比如有一款基于VueJS的滑块组件就非常不错。滑杆这种控件一般用在范围选取上面,比如结合图表生成一定范围的数据。今天我们分享的这个滑杆控件自定义程度非常高,特别是使用了CSS3的3D特性,让整一个滑杆控件效果更加炫酷。插件预览插件下载在线演示链接:https://www.html5tricks.com/demo/html5-css3-3d-slide
原创
2021-01-17 16:48:09
349阅读
本次 用到 CSS3 的
transition(过渡) 属性,
一共有4个属性
transition-property 属性规定 应用过渡效果的 CSS 属性的名称
transition-duration 属性规定 完成过渡效果需要花费的时间(以秒(s)或毫秒(ms)计)。
transition-timing-function 属性规定过渡效果的速度曲线。
转载
2016-03-22 19:56:00
55阅读
信息化技术逐渐从二维转向三维,3D行业迎来最重大的发展趋势。在三维建模技术和网络信息化的深度融合下,很多行业领域的H5三维3D模型可视化增强笔记本电脑行业虚拟现实技术趋势分析,三维交互展示掀起笔记本电脑产品展示营销新模式。商迪3D运用三维数字化建模技术、3D可视化技术、三维虚拟现实技术、H5三维展示技术等助力笔记本产品全新网络线上营销新模式,专业新型技术进行产品转型和三维线上模型展示。跟传统二维营
转载
2023-10-21 15:52:46
99阅读
# 学习CSS3与HTML5的流程与实现
作为一名刚入行的小白,学习如何使用HTML5和CSS3构建网页可能会让人感到棘手。然而,只要掌握了基础步骤和方法,你将能轻松实现美观且功能丰富的网页。在本文中,我将为你提供一个学习流程,并指导你通过具体的代码实现基本的网页布局。
## 学习流程表
| 步骤 | 任务 | 描述
第六章 链接1、创建指向另一网页的链接:<a href=”http://www.site.com/directory/page.html ” rel=”external”>Lable text</a>2、HTML块级链接:HTML5几乎允许在链接内包含任何类型的元素或元素组,例如段落、列表、区块,但是其他链接、音频、视频、表
转载
2023-12-06 20:43:37
52阅读